Output 36816aa0a036e69efd0c20528cbeadfb0cc09d823ce101503b29b70ac514aa02:25

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bca59ab150d746db4eaf5ebe7253fde10f779dc OP_EQUAL
address
3QeMwEeqrbpKRoqYgYK5yNBCB1v3RE1ejQ
transaction
36816aa0a036e69efd0c20528cbeadfb0cc09d823ce101503b29b70ac514aa02
spent
true